Form 4: Uwharrie Capital Corp Director Acquires Shares as Part of Annual Retainer
SEC Form 4 Filing
Director S. Todd Swaringen acquired 178 shares of Uwharrie Capital Corp common stock as part of his annual retainer.
Summary
- S. Todd Swaringen, a director at Uwharrie Capital Corp, acquired 178 shares of common stock on December 16, 2024.
- The shares were acquired as part of his annual retainer for serving as a director.
- The acquisition price was $8.4223 per share, representing a weighted average price.
- Following the transaction, Mr. Swaringen directly owns 2,177 shares and indirectly owns 2,187 shares through Cede & Co.
